Irma Sekata in Sepang, Selangor recorded 8 subsale transactions between 2021 and 2026, sized between 1,675 and 1,724 sqft, with a median price of RM646K and a median price per square foot (PSF) of RM375.

This area consists exclusively of residential properties, with no commercial listings recorded.

Price remained flat, and PSF growth was PSF remained flat. The median price is RM646K, with most transactions falling within a stable range of RM643K to RM684K, and a typical market range of RM644K to RM647K.

Most transactions involved 2 - 2 1/2 storey terraced, with minimal variety in property types.

For price per square foot, the median is RM375, with most transactions between RM353 and RM397. The usual range is RM370.30 to RM379.30, showing that most units are priced quite close to each other. A typical spread (IQR) of RM9.00 and an average deviation (MAD) of RM22 indicate a highly stable PSF trend across properties.
